I just found an awesome website (after seeing a TV ad for it) and it's called DonorsChoose.Org

Directly from their website:

Quote
DonorsChooseSM is a simple way to provide students in need with resources that our public schools often lack. At this not-for-profit web site, teachers submit project proposals for materials or experiences their students need to learn. These ideas become classroom reality when concerned individuals, whom we call Citizen Philanthropists, choose projects to fund.

Right now you can choose projects to help fund in the following regions:

Alabama
Chicago
Los Angeles
Louisiana
Mississippi
New York City
North Carolina
San Francisco Bay Area
South Carolina
Texas

You can search by region or keyword. You can also browse by region, subject, type of resource, cost of completion and student profiles. The site also allows you to give gift certificates to others that allows them to choose what project they'd like to fund.
